Motion Sensor LED High Bays with UGR
Motion sensor LED high bays are an advanced lighting solution that combines energy efficiency with smart functionality. These high bays are equipped with motion sensors that activate the lights only when movement is detected, thereby reducing energy consumption. The “UGR” in the product name signifies that the lighting system has been designed to minimize glare and provide a uniform light distribution, which is essential for maintaining visual comfort and safety in large spaces. Key Features and Benefits of LED Emergency Lighting Solutions
LED emergency lighting solutions offer several key features and benefits that make them a preferred choice for a wide range of applications:
-
Energy Efficiency: LEDs consume significantly less energy than traditional lighting sources, resulting in lower operating costs and reduced environmental impact.
-
Durability: LEDs have a longer lifespan than conventional bulbs, requiring less frequent replacement and reducing maintenance costs.
-
Low Heat Output: LEDs emit very little heat, making them safer to use in environments where heat can be a concern.
-
Customizable Solutions: LED lighting systems can be tailored to meet specific requirements, including color temperature, lumen output, and UGR ratings.
-
Smart Functionality: Many LED lighting solutions include smart features, such as motion sensors and remote controls, to enhance energy efficiency and user convenience.
